def parse(options):
|
|
"""Parse options from string.
|
|
|
|
Args:
|
|
options (str): String with options.
|
|
It should have the form 'arg1=value1,arg2=value2,...'.
|
|
|
|
Returns:
|
|
dict: {'arg1': value1, 'arg2': value2, ...}
|
|
|
|
"""
|
|
kwargs = {}
|
|
if options is not None:
|
|
for parameter in options.split(","):
|
|
if "=" in parameter:
|
|
k, v = parameter.split("=")
|
|
kwargs[k] = v
|
|
else:
|
|
raise ValueError(f"Cannot parse parameter {parameter}.")
|
|
return kwargs
